One of the most anticipated games for the PS3 this year and is really a sending off point of what the Ps3 can bring. I have previously spoke about the last of us and we've been shown loads of what the game is about and how it will play. So why is it at E3 4 days before release?  What were hoping for is the part of the last of us we've not seen yet, Multiplayer. Naughty dog have confirmed multiplayer will be integrated but we just don't know how yet. So naughty dog are sure to show how multiplayer will work and if it will be worth it. Such games with amazing long stories don't actually have good multiplayer and it comes across as just an add on. Will the last of us be different?
